WebJul 23, 2024 · Skin rashes are notoriously hard to define, as they can involve so many different features: itchiness, redness, bumpiness, roughness, scaliness, swelling, and irritation, to name but a few. But not every rash will share the same characteristics, and appearances can vary widely even between early cases and those that are more advanced.
